Carol Woods
Carol Woods (born November 13, 1943) is an American actress and singer. She is best known for her roles in Sweet and Lowdown (1999), The Honeymooners (2005) and Across the Universe (2007). In addition to her acting career, Woods has showcased her vocal talent by singing songs from various soundtracks. In February 2008, she received a standing ovation during the 50th Grammy Awards broadcast for her rendition of 'Let It Be' from the Across the Universe soundtrack, alongside Timothy Mitchum. Inspired by Barack Obama's campaign, Woods recorded Julie Gold's song 'America' and released it in 2009. She has also performed on Broadway in Chicago, reprising the role of Matron 'Mama' Morton.
